Transaction 7d303483cea4b8051bf527e78d88ad870f470023e9587194613583482da08f41
1 Input
1 Output
-
7d303483cea4b8051bf527e78d88ad870f470023e9587194613583482da08f41:0
- value
- 389951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9017f59e08375b1e1380758ed23866229398ac85 OP_EQUAL
- address
- 3Epuvu57tSQ8wiWyiCtVD1BqFo3d85cKTa